SOCW 660 - Clinical Practice with Groups


Credits: 3

This course combines instruction with interactive discussions and experiential learning opportunities to provide students with a comprehensive and practical understanding of family and group therapy. The course integrates theoretical knowledge with practical skills, emphasizing cultural competence and humility within an evidence-based framework to providing therapeutic interventions. Students will engage in active participation, self-reflection, and collaborative learning to develop the necessary skills and competencies for effective and ethical practice in the field of family and group therapy.

Prerequisite(s): Admission to the MSW program and second-year or advanced-standing status

Term(s) Offered: Fall
